Some experts say chickens don’t really start suffering until the temperature inside their coop falls to minus … Web25 de out. de 2024 · Chicks without a heat lamp or mother hen to keep them warm will need to be at least 6 weeks old and fully feathered before they are moved outside. 4 or 5 weeks old is too young for baby chicks to live outside. Small breeds of chicken or slow feathering types will likely need to be 8 or 10 weeks old before they live outdoors.

Web6-week-old chickens should be ready to move from the brooder to the chicken coop if the outdoor temperature is at least 50 degrees Fahrenheit. Make the transition from the brooder to the chicken coop slowly so chicks can acclimate to their new home.
